03.What are the failure modes when extracting outputs using DSPy and LangChain?
In the event of malformed prompts or unexpected input formats, the LLM may generate incorrect or incomplete data. Implement validation checks on both input and output phases. Additionally, use a fallback mechanism to handle errors gracefully, such as retrying with adjusted prompts or reverting to a default output schema.

05.How do DSPy and LangChain compare to traditional data extraction methods?
Unlike conventional extraction methods that rely on static rules, DSPy and LangChain provide dynamic, context-aware output extraction. This allows for greater flexibility and adaptability in handling diverse data inputs. However, traditional methods may offer better performance for well-defined, repetitive tasks due to lower overheads.
